Activation via coding (Pairing Code)

If direct login with your username and password is not possible or convenient, use the code activation method. This method is especially useful if you want to link your device to your primary account without re-entering your credentials. Open the app on your TV and select "Log in with code."

A unique combination of numbers and letters will appear on the screen. This same combination must be entered in your personal account on the provider's website or in the device management section of the mobile app. Once the pairing is confirmed, the TV will automatically log in.

The advantage of this method is its high level of security, as you don't need to enter your account password directly on the TV screen. This is especially important if you share a TV or are concerned about data leakage.

  • 🔢 Open the app and select "Log in with code."
  • 📲 Log in to your Beeline account from your phone or PC.
  • 📝 Enter the displayed code into the appropriate field on the website.
  • ✅ Confirm the action, and access will open instantly.

Setting up a WiFi network for stable operation

Image quality directly depends on your wireless network settings. If you experience image artifacts or audio delays, try adjusting your router settings. The optimal solution is to switch to a different band. 5 GHz, which is less loaded with neighboring networks.

It's also recommended to set a static IP address for your TV in your router settings or reserve an address based on its MAC address. This will prevent addressing conflicts when the router assigns an address to the TV that is already in use by another device, which can sometimes happen when there are many devices on the network.

Why is 5 GHz better for TV?

The 5 GHz band provides faster data transfer rates and is less susceptible to interference from microwave ovens and Bluetooth devices, but has a shorter range than 2.4 GHz.

Make sure your router doesn't have WiFi client isolation enabled, if available. This feature is designed for office networks and prevents devices within the network from exchanging data, which can block some Smart TV features.

Solving common connection problems

Users often encounter a situation where the app launches, but the content doesn't play. First, check the system time and date on your TV. If they're incorrect, security certificates won't be verified, and the connection to the server will be lost.

Another common cause is an overflowing app cache. Go to your TV settings, navigate to "All Settings" -> "General" -> "Storage" (or a similar path depending on your version of WebOS), and clear the app data. Beeline TV.

In some cases, a complete reset of the network settings on the TV helps. Go to Settings → Network → WiFi Connection, select your network, and tap "Forget." Then, re-enter your WiFi password. This refreshes the network protocols and often resolves connection freezes.

Using an external set-top box as an alternative

If the embedded system WebOS If your device is running slowly or the app isn't available for your model, purchasing an external set-top box is a great solution. Android TV, such as Mi Box or Chromecast, allow you to install the mobile version of the application through Google Play.

Connection is via the HDMI port. All you need is a stable Wi-Fi connection and a remote control for your set-top box (or smartphone). This method often provides a performance boost, as the computing load is transferred to a separate device rather than the TV's processor.

When choosing a set-top box, pay attention to the codec support H.265 (HEVC), which is used to broadcast channels in high quality. Without this codec, the picture may be black and white or absent altogether, but the sound will be normal.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Why won't the Beeline TV app launch on my LG?

Most often, the cause is an outdated version of the WebOS operating system. Check for software updates in your TV settings. The issue may also be due to model incompatibility if it was released before 2016.

Is it possible to watch archived programs via WiFi without a set-top box?

Yes, the archive feature is available in the Smart TV app. However, recording programs (the "Pause TV" feature and cloud recording) may require a Beeline set-top box, as built-in apps often have limited functionality compared to the set-top box.

What is the minimum speed required for 4K content?

For comfortable viewing of Ultra HD (4K) content, an internet speed of at least 25-30 Mbps is recommended. At lower speeds, the system will automatically reduce image quality to avoid constant buffering.

How do I log out of my account in the app on my TV?

Go to the app settings (usually the gear icon or user profile), scroll down, and select "Log out" or "Deactivate device." You'll then need to log in again to access the content.
